[FPGA]Modelsim无法生成License文件解决方式
下载并安装Modelsim:在非管理员账户下,下载Modelsim的安装包。按照安装向导的指示完成Modelsim的安装。运行License生成脚本:在非管理员账户下,找到Modelsim安装包中的License生成脚本(通常是.bat文件)。
解决方法:关闭Modelsim:确保之前的Modelsim界面已经完全关闭。如果Modelsim仍在后台运行,可能会锁定某些文件,导致无法删除或修改。检查权限:确认当前用户具有对Modelsim工作目录及其文件的读写权限。在某些操作系统中,可能需要以管理员身份运行Modelsim。
在尝试删除“msim_transcript”时遇到permission denied错误,这通常是因为Modelsim界面未关闭。解决办法是先关闭Modelsim,然后重启软件,以确保所有相关文件的权限问题得到解决。通过上述方法,可以有效解决QuartusII10和Modelsim中遇到的常见报错问题。
配置Modelsim:打开Modelsim,将前面设置的编译库路径下的modelsim.ini配置文件拷贝到Modelsim的安装路径下。然后,在Modelsim的Library列表中查看是否出现了所编译的库名称,以确认库编译是否成功。
单击【Yes】,建立桌面快捷方式,单击【Yes】,单击【Yes】,单击【Yes】,重启计算机。
接着,在Modelsim安装路径下新建一个文件夹(vivado_lib),用于存储仿真库。在Vivado中使用Compile Simulation Libraries开始编译仿真库。设置完成后,添加testbench文件到工程,然后综合实现并执行时序仿真。仿真在FPGA开发中至关重要。不进行仿真直接上板验证,往往会导致大量时间浪费在解决低级错误上。
Modelsim无法关闭cantreadproject一种解决办法
解决Modelsim无法关闭并提示“cant read project”问题的一种有效方法是:通过工具栏操作找到并删除项目文件,之后即可正常关闭软件。问题描述:当使用Modelsim创建项目后退出软件时,系统会提示“error cant read project (Echocpmpile output)”,且无论选择任何选项均无法关闭软件。
PDS软件使用指南(五)仿真——modelsim联合仿真
使用PDS软件进行ModelSim联合仿真是一个复杂但重要的过程。通过正确编译仿真库、编写tb文件和运行仿真,开发者可以验证代码的正确性并发现潜在的问题。同时,利用ModelSim提供的监视和调试工具可以更加深入地理解代码的行为并优化其性能。因此,在FPGA开发过程中,仿真是一个不可或缺的环节,应该得到足够的重视和关注。
准备阶段 在PDS工程界面中,点击【tools】菜单下的【Compile Simulation Libraries】选项,准备开始仿真库的编译。配置仿真环境 选择仿真工具:将【Simulator】设置为ModelSim。设定编程语言:通过【Language】选项设定仿真库的编程语言。
一:准备阶段 进入工程界面后,点击位于PDS的【tools】菜单下的【Compile Simulation Libraries】选项,准备进行仿真库的编译。二:配置仿真环境 在弹出的设置界面中,选择【Simulator】为第三方仿真工具,当前支持ModelSim和QuestaSim,教程将采用ModelSim作为仿真平台。
紫光Pango Design Suite与Modelsim的联合仿真环境搭建与使用流程如下:方法一:利用Pango Design Suite编译仿真库 启动Pango Design Suite,进入Tools菜单,选择Compile Simulation Libraries。在此窗口中设定所需的器件库、编译库路径及Modelsim路径。点击Compile,直至编译完成。
Vivado与Modelsim关联方法及器件库编译
Vivado与Modelsim关联方法及器件库编译的步骤如下:Vivado与Modelsim的关联 设置Modelsim安装路径:打开Vivado,导航到“Tools”“Options”。选择“General”标签页,找到“QuestaSim/ModelSim install path”区域。设置或选择Modelsim的安装路径。
首先,打开Vivado,导航到“Tools”“Options...”,选择“General”标签页,找到“QuestaSim/ModelSim install path”区域,设置或选择Modelsim的安装路径。接着,为器件库编译做准备。在Modelsim安装目录下创建一个名为“vivado2014_lib”的文件夹(可自定义路径和名称),如图所示。
选择要编译的库(默认选择“All”)。根据实际使用情况选择器件系列。选择的器件系列越多,编译生成库的时间越长。编译库存放路径和仿真软件Modelsim路径默认是之前设置的路径,确认无误后点击“Compile”开始编译。设置仿真选项:编译完成后,为了在Vivado中自动关联调用Modelsim进行仿真,还需要进行仿真设置。
在Vivado中编译库:确保在Vivado中正确编译了ModelSim所需的Xilinx库,包括器件库和IP核库。选择正确的ModelSim版本:在编译过程中,确保选择了与你的ModelSim版本相匹配的Vivado设置。勾选编译选项:确保在编译过程中勾选了“compile xilinx ip”选项,以包含所有必要的IP核库。
首先,进入设置,在Tool Settings下方的3rd Party Simulators中选择Modelsim,填写安装路径后点击OK。接着,在Modelsim安装路径下新建一个文件夹(vivado_lib),用于存储仿真库。在Vivado中使用Compile Simulation Libraries开始编译仿真库。设置完成后,添加testbench文件到工程,然后综合实现并执行时序仿真。
方法一:利用Pango Design Suite编译仿真库 启动Pango Design Suite,进入Tools菜单,选择Compile Simulation Libraries。在此窗口中设定所需的器件库、编译库路径及Modelsim路径。点击Compile,直至编译完成。接着,将编译库路径下的modelsim.ini文件复制到Modelsim安装目录中。
multisim和modelsim有什么区别
Multisim 原ewb和OrCADPSPISE仿模拟电路QuartusIIMAX+PLUS II仿数字电路当然如果你不用 Altera公司的可编程逻辑器件用Xilinx公司的,就要用ISE设计,Modelsim做仿真了这两个软件都只能仿真数字逻辑电路,没有任何模拟器件。
对于特定电路模块的仿真,电源设计有power stage和WEBENCH Power Designer,它们能够根据用户需求自动生成电路设计,但通常局限于特定芯片制造商的硬件。在高频电路领域,ADS、HFSS和CST等软件如鱼得水,专门处理传输线效应,为高频电路设计提供精确的解决方案。
EDA软件包括多种类型,其中一些广泛使用的EDA软件有Protel、Altium Designer、KiCad、OrCAD、EWB、PSPICE、multiSIMPCAD、LSIIogic、MicroSim、ISE、ModelSim以及MATLAB等。这些软件在电子设计自动化领域发挥着重要作用,帮助工程师高效地完成电路设计、仿真、PCB布局布线等工作。
VR-Platform VR-Platform(英文全拼为Virtual Reality Platform,简称VR-Platform或VRP)即虚拟现实仿真平台。该仿真软件适用性强、操作简单、功能强大、高度可视化、所见即所得。VR-Platform虚拟现实仿真平台所有的操作都是以美工可以理解的方式进行,不需要程序员参与。
中高端品牌筛选;标准封装;在线原理图 pcb;导入ad文件;大量开源硬件 大量开源封装直接调用。进入我国并具有广泛影响的EDA软件是系统设计软件辅助类和可编程芯片辅助设计软件:Protel、PSPICE、multiSIM10(原EWB的最新版本)、OrCAD、PCAD、LSIIogic、MicroSim,ISE,modelsim等等。
EDA常用软件:EDA工具层出不穷,目前进入我国并具有广泛影响的EDA软件有:multiSIM7(原EWB的最新版本)、PSPICE、 OrCAD、PCAD、Protel、Viewlogic、Mentor、Graphics、Synopsys、LSIIogic、Cadence、 MicroSim,ISE,modelsim等等。
转载请注明来自海坡下载,本文标题:《(4分马上明白)ModelSim-全面剖析》
京公网安备11000000000001号
京ICP备11000001号
还没有评论,来说两句吧...